| package org.apache.commons.collections.bag; |
| |
| import java.util.Comparator; |
| |
| import org.apache.commons.collections.Predicate; |
| import org.apache.commons.collections.SortedBag; |
| |
| /** |
| * Decorates another <code>SortedBag</code> to validate that additions |
| * match a specified predicate. |
| * <p> |
| * This bag exists to provide validation for the decorated bag. |
| * It is normally created to decorate an empty bag. |
| * If an object cannot be added to the bag, an IllegalArgumentException is thrown. |
| * <p> |
| * One usage would be to ensure that no null entries are added to the bag. |
| * <pre>SortedBag bag = PredicatedSortedBag.decorate(new TreeBag(), NotNullPredicate.INSTANCE);</pre> |
| * <p> |
| * This class is Serializable from Commons Collections 3.1. |
| * |
| * @since Commons Collections 3.0 |
| * @version $Revision: 1.1 $ $Date: 2009/05/27 22:16:34 $ |
| * |
| * @author Stephen Colebourne |
| * @author Paul Jack |
| */ |
| public class PredicatedSortedBag |
| extends PredicatedBag implements SortedBag { |
| |
| /** Serialization version */ |
| private static final long serialVersionUID = 3448581314086406616L; |
| |
| /** |
| * Factory method to create a predicated (validating) bag. |
| * <p> |
| * If there are any elements already in the bag being decorated, they |
| * are validated. |
| * |
| * @param bag the bag to decorate, must not be null |
| * @param predicate the predicate to use for validation, must not be null |
| * @return a new predicated SortedBag |
| * @throws IllegalArgumentException if bag or predicate is null |
| * @throws IllegalArgumentException if the bag contains invalid elements |
| */ |
| public static SortedBag decorate(SortedBag bag, Predicate predicate) { |
| return new PredicatedSortedBag(bag, predicate); |
| } |
| |
| //----------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| /** |
| * Constructor that wraps (not copies). |
| * <p> |
| * If there are any elements already in the bag being decorated, they |
| * are validated. |
| * |
| * @param bag the bag to decorate, must not be null |
| * @param predicate the predicate to use for validation, must not be null |
| * @throws IllegalArgumentException if bag or predicate is null |
| * @throws IllegalArgumentException if the bag contains invalid elements |
| */ |
| protected PredicatedSortedBag(SortedBag bag, Predicate predicate) { |
| super(bag, predicate); |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Gets the decorated sorted bag. |
| * |
| * @return the decorated bag |
| */ |
| protected SortedBag getSortedBag() { |
| return (SortedBag) getCollection(); |
| } |
| |
| //----------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| public Object first() { |
| return getSortedBag().first(); |
| } |
| |
| public Object last() { |
| return getSortedBag().last(); |
| } |
| |
| public Comparator comparator() { |
| return getSortedBag().comparator(); |
| } |
| |
| } |
